Recommendations for Spanish Language media

Hey everyone. I'm pretty advanced in Duolingo (Spanish level 98), and I'm having more trouble retaining the new lessons as they get more complex. So I'm interested in Spanish language media of all sorts that might help me solidify what I learned/get me used to Spanish language. My suggestions are below, but I'd be interested in what other people like. (another thing I like about this stuff is coming back to the same thing over time and see how much more I understand it)

Books:

Asterix books (translated to spanish, I have Asterix en Hispania, and enjoy it)

House on Mango Street (translated to Spanish, so "Casa En Mango Street")

Music:

Bad Bunny (Caribbean accent, but I'm understanding more and more as I listen)

Gypsy Kings

Manu Chao

TV:

I just try to watch whatever is on Univision, but I'd be interested in any Spanish language films or TV shows that I could watch.
